RTE viewers were full of praise for 'humble' Joe Canning after his appearance on the Tommy Tiernan Show.

The Galway legend appeared on the popular chat show alongside his brother and retired hurler Ollie for a chat. Speaking about their hurling career, Ollie said: "There were six boys in our family and there were lots of years where the oldest would beat up the next guy and he'd beat up the next guy and you'd learn to look after yourself really well.

"There was always rough and tumble with us growing up and I think we probably got hardened up around the farm at home and around the rough and tumble around the home".One viewer said: "Great interview@Tommedian I must say @JoeyCan88 came across so humble & full of humility. If only more people involved in the GAA were like that".READ MORE:
